A World in Common @Tate Celebrates Contemporary African Photography
Tate Gallery hosts an exhibition where artists explore how various mediums reshape Africa’s cultures and historical narratives.
This Tate Modern exhibition delves into how images traverse histories and geographies, guiding visitors through themes like spirituality, identity, urbanism, and climate emergency.
The exhibition spans landscapes, borders, and time zones of Africa, demonstrating how photography bridges the past and future in transformative ways.
Visitors can explore Common Ground, a free space for reading, resting, and reflection, before or after experiencing the exhibition.
